Parc de Oriental in Maulévrier, France

I am pleased to announce this International Chinese Calligraphy and Ink Painting Society (ICCPS) exhibition.

Dates: August 25 - September 2,  2012

In the largest oriental park in Europe, an international sumi-e and calligraphy exhibit will be held on the above dates. Twenty-one artists from 10 different countries will be participating in the prestigious event. I am honored to represent the United States in this exhibition of beautiful artwork.
 
The exhibit is sponsored by the ICCPS -
 International Chinese Calligraphy and Ink Painting Society under the direction of the French Branch Director, Mr. Gregory Cortecero

This art gallery contains images created using sumi (ink) and watercolor painted  on Shuen Paper (Xuan Paper).  What is Shuen Paper you might ask? It is Chinese rice paper. Rice paper is the brush painter's canvas. Mastering the way ink behaves on the different rice papers is one of the essential skills of the brush painter. There are basically two kinds of rice paper -- raw paper and sized paper. Shuen Paper (Xuan Paper) is raw paper and the most popular paper in China among brush painters and calligraphers. It is the most sensitive of the rice papers, cheerfully displaying dynamic strokes and complex shade variations with translucent fluidity and original spontaneity.  Any brush painter will tell you it is difficult to work with rice paper and takes years of practice to master.
